Service Manual (Manual No. KM-1HH-E) consists of the following three separate volumes;
Technical Manual (Operational Principle) : Vol. No. TO1HH-E
Technical Manual (Troubleshooting) : Vol. No. TT1HH-E
Workshop Manual : Vol. No. W1HH-E
